N. Baldwin home is in the Poet Section with a 1 car garage, Westbury split level home is a short sale (which seems to be the trend in this town) in Sherwood Gardens. School system does not matter as I do not have or anticipate any children. I am aware of the 6g property tax difference, however I am leaning towards Westbury, due to the proximity of big box stores, RF Mall, LIE/NSP for my daily driving commute and ability to at least finally have both of my cars in the garage. However, I do like the diversity of Baldwin and the charm of the Poet Section homes.

Excluding the other towns in Nassau County, which one of these homes is worth it? Both are ~$350k.

I would go for the N.Baldwin house.

Even though I personally love Westbury too, especially the section that you're looking at, you get so little back for the astronomical taxes that you pay. Why pay all of those taxes for the [crappy] public schools that you'll never use and for an ineffective village govt?

In Baldwin, you're still only 10 minutes away from the RF Mall so distance shouldn't be a problem unless you're a SEVERE shopaholic who has to constantly be there. And if you save that extra $6k/yr in taxes then you will probably be able to afford a larger house in Baldwin or elsewhere with a two-car garage...just some food for thought

Oh...you must be referring to me.
I am not out to bash Westbury, only to point out its problems. Never said anything bad about Salisbury, its a nice area and has East Meadow schools, and is generally more desirable than East Meadow itself.
Bichwood Knolls/Sherwood...pretty much anything north of the parkway is nice, especially once west of Eillison, that is Carle Place schools but you will pay for it.
My main complaints about Westbury have to do with the central part of town around Post Ave and to the east. This is where the illegals are and where you'll see the loitering & gang activity. You would think being near money to the north and west would rub off on Post Ave but we're still waiting. The Space has been one big joke, I feel bad for the businesses here on Post hoping it would have brought them more patrons, unfortunately without much going on @ The Space, they suffer. The busiest places on Post are bodegas...and there are 7 of them so thats not a good thing. I aint out to bash Westbury, I just want it cleaned up, especially since I'm stuck living here...what's so wrong about that? Having grown men just hanging around all the time certainly isn't an asset to a community, right?
As far as N.Baldwin vs Westbury, it of course depends where in Westbury. I would prefer Salisbury over N.Baldwin, you'll get better schools, more nearby, and more distance from Hempstead (N.Baldwin is way too close).
Of course, you may find better train service at Baldwin vs. Westbury.
